Berean Christian High School

http://www.berean-eagles.org

Berean Christian High School is primarily a college preparatory high school where the Christian faith is fully integrated into all courses. It is located in Walnut Creek, California, 25 miles east of San Francisco. It has served the east bay area since 1969 and has been located at the Walnut Creek campus since 1985.
